Web25 oct. 2024 · So when the English in 1803 took over Delhi from Marathas, they kept the Mughal Emperor on the throne. Despite the respect commanded by the Mughal Emperor, he held almost no power. Even small matters needed English consent. It was in such a set-up that Bahadur Shah Zafar was born on 24 October 1775 to Mughal Emperor Akbar II. Web29 mai 2024 · Shah Jahan, whose name means “King of the World,” was born in what is now Pakistan in 1592. He came from a long line of successful Mughal emperors, including his grandfather Akbar the Great, and was the third son of Emperor Jahangir. Web23 mai 2024 · The Mughals have left an undeniable imprint upon the Indian landscape; their legacy is seen in the form of culture, architecture and art. Their rule lasted for more than 300 years, from 1526 to 1857. There have been a whole brood of Mughal emperors, but none stood out as much as the first six, the creators of the Mughal legacy. WebThe very next year Humāyūn died in an accident in his library. This event left his 12-year old son, Akbar, the task of consolidating Mughal power in northern India. WebMughal Empire narrowed merely as the Kingdom of Delhi. Delhi itself was a scene of 'daily riot and tumult'. Shah Alam II, who ascended the throne in 1759, spent the initial years as an Emperor wandering from place to place far away from his capital, for he lived in mortal fear of his own war.
